-
常用快捷鍵
查看全部 -
快捷鍵?。。?!
查看全部 -
圖片類型1
查看全部 -
Flutter是谷歌的移動UI框架,可以快速在IOS和Android上構建高質量的原生用戶界面。Flutter可以與現有的代碼一起工作,并且它是免費、開源的。
特點:
1、跨平臺:Linux、Android、IOS、Fuchsia
2、原生用戶界面:它是原生的,讓我們體驗更好、性能更好
3、開源免費:完全開源,可以進行商用
與主流框架對比:
Cordova:混合式開發框架(Hybrid App)
RN(React Native):生成原生的APP,但以View為基礎嵌入
Flutter:在渲染技術上選擇了自己實現(GDI)
查看全部 -
圖片鏈接給大家貼一下,給后面學的方便:
http://img5.mtime.cn/mt/2018/10/22/104316.77318635_180X260X4.jpg
http://img5.mtime.cn/mt/2018/10/10/112514.30587089_180X260X4.jpg
http://img5.mtime.cn/mt/2018/11/13/093605.61422332_180X260X4.jpg
http://img5.mtime.cn/mt/2018/11/07/092515.55805319_180X260X4.jpg
http://img5.mtime.cn/mt/2018/11/21/090246.16772408_135X190X4.jpg
http://img5.mtime.cn/mt/2018/11/17/162028.94879602_135X190X4.jpg
查看全部 -
學習flutter建議先學習dart語法,會dart語法會發現簡單許多
查看全部 -
flutter sdk地址:https://flutter.dev/docs/development/tools/sdk/releases#windows
查看全部 -
參照本課程,自己理解寫的博客文檔,大家可以看一下
https://www.jianshu.com/p/afee6508f9cc
查看全部 -
簡書? ?https://www.jianshu.com/p/afee6508f9cc
橫向列表顧名思義就是,可以通過水平方向進行一個列表的滑動,左右滑動列表Item,即可瀏覽ListView的數據了。
scrollDirection屬性的使用
- Axis.vertical:垂直方向
- Axis.horizontal 水平方向
非常簡單,我們直接修改屬性值就可以完成不同方向的ListView
查看全部 -
簡書:https://www.jianshu.com/p/afee6508f9cc
可以看到,我們在new的時候,傳遞了一個List對象給構造器,通過List的generate方法快速生成一個1000大小的列表。
然后在類的構造器中去接收到這個List參數,然后給類的ListView組件使用,達到動態數據,list的數據源是由外部接收的,這樣我們的ListView數據將會非常靈活。
查看全部 -
簡書地址:Flutter基礎筆記??https://www.jianshu.com/p/afee6508f9cc
總結:
StatelessWidget、build()、MaterialApp->title->home、腳手架Scaffold、appBar、body、Center->child
1. 首先繼承StatelessWidget抽象類,實現bulid方法
2. return一個MaterialApp
3. 定義App內的title,和home
4. home屬性需要返回腳手架Scaffold組件
5. 腳手架定義appBar和body屬性,appBar中定義text,body中創建Center
6. 在Center居中組件中,利用child屬性,返回一個TextWidget,用來顯示內容
查看全部 -
圖片地址拿走不謝。。。>_<
children:?<Widget>[ ??new?Image.network('http://img5.mtime.cn/mg/2019/03/21/105842.67810645_170X256X4.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/04/10/102844.93012572_170X256X4.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/04/19/092928.24468397_170X256X4.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/03/29/095612.14234221_170X256X4.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/04/01/170857.92282290_170X256X4.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/04/16/103242.17522323_170X256X4.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/04/04/092846.29725044_1280X720X2.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/01/31/100731.93352385_1280X720X2.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/04/15/095157.26388695_1280X720X2.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/03/21/105842.67810645_170X256X4.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/04/10/102844.93012572_170X256X4.jpg',fit:?BoxFit.cover,), ??new?Image.network('http://img5.mtime.cn/mg/2019/04/19/092928.24468397_170X256X4.jpg',fit:?BoxFit.cover,), ],
查看全部 -
與主流框架對比查看全部
-
優點查看全部
-
https://github.com/TKMapleLeaf/awesome-flutter
查看全部
舉報